Linux 시스템에서 Oracle의 설치 경로에 대한 자세한 소개
Oracle 설치 경로 Linux
Oracle은 매우 널리 사용되는 관계형 데이터베이스 관리 시스템입니다. Linux 시스템에서 Oracle을 설치하는 것은 매우 흔한 일이지만, 초보자는 설치 경로 설정 및 관련 구성을 이해하지 못하는 경우가 많습니다. 이번 글에서는 Linux 시스템에서 Oracle의 설치 경로를 자세히 소개하겠습니다.
1. Oracle 설치 전 준비
Oracle을 설치하기 전에 시스템에 다음을 포함하여 필요한 종속성이 설치되어 있는지 확인해야 합니다.
- gcc: C 언어 컴파일용 컴파일러
- libaio: 비동기식 입력 및 출력용
- libstdc++: C++ 런타임 라이브러리에 사용
- libXtst: X Window System 테스트 라이브러리에 사용
설치 방법은 다음과 같습니다.
$ sudo yum install gcc libaio libstdc++ libXtst
2. Oracle 설치 경로를 설정합니다.
Oracle 설치 시 Oracle 관련 서비스를 실행하는 데 사용되는 새 사용자 및 그룹. Oracle을 실행하기 위해 oracle 사용자를 생성할 수 있습니다. 사용자를 생성하는 명령은 다음과 같습니다.
$ sudo groupadd oinstall $ sudo useradd -g oinstall oracle $ sudo passwd oracle
사용자를 생성한 후 Oracle의 설치 경로를 설정해야 합니다. 여기서는 /opt 디렉터리에 Oracle을 설치합니다. 먼저 /opt 디렉토리의 소유자가 oracle 사용자인지 확인해야 합니다.
$ sudo chown -R oracle:oinstall /opt
그런 다음 Oracle 설치 및 데이터 저장을 위한 새 디렉토리를 만들어야 합니다.
$ sudo mkdir /opt/oracle $ sudo chown oracle:oinstall /opt/oracle
다음으로 Oracle 공식 웹사이트를 방문해야 합니다. 설치 프로그램을 다운로드하여 설치하려면 /opt/oracle 디렉토리에 압축을 푼다:
$ cd /opt/oracle $ unzip /path/to/oracle/installer.zip
압축 해제가 완료된 후
$ chown -R oracle:oinstall /opt/oracle $ chmod -R u+w /opt/oracle
3 폴더를 승인해야 합니다. Oracle 설치
이제 Oracle을 설치할 준비가 되었습니다. , 일련의 단계를 수행해야 합니다. 단계:
- Oracle 설치 프로그램 시작:
$ cd /opt/oracle/database $ sudo ./runInstaller
- 팝업 창에서 "데이터베이스 소프트웨어 설치"를 선택하고 다음을 클릭합니다.
- 다음 인터페이스에서
- 제품 구성에서 마법사에서 "단일 인스턴스 Oracle 데이터베이스 설치"를 선택하고 다음을 클릭합니다.
- 시스템 범주에서 "서버 클래스"를 선택하고 다음을 클릭합니다.
- 대상 위치에서 다음을 선택합니다. "Oracle Base Directory" 및 "Software Location" "은 /opt/oracle이고 다음을 클릭합니다.
- 이때 경고가 표시됩니다. 경고 내용에 따라 해당 수정이 필요합니다. 수정이 완료된 후 다음을 클릭합니다. 다시 확인하세요:
- 라이브러리 파일 위치 설정 인터페이스에서 "동일한 디렉토리 사용"을 선택하고 "소프트웨어 위치"를 /opt/oracle/oracle/product/11.2.0/dbhome_1로 변경한 후 다음을 클릭하세요.
- 설치에서 옵션에서 "메모리 선택"을 선택하고 시스템 사용 가능한 메모리의 80%를 입력한 후 다음을 클릭합니다.
- 확인을 완료한 후 모든 단계가 올바른지 확인하고 다음을 클릭합니다.
- 설치가 완료될 때까지 기다립니다.
- 설치 과정에서 구성 오류가 발생할 수 있으니 오류 설명에 따라 조정하시기 바랍니다.
IV.결론
위의 단계를 통해 Linux 시스템에서 Oracle의 설치 경로를 설정하고 설치를 완료하면 동시에 데이터베이스 관리 서비스에도 Oracle을 사용할 수 있게 됩니다. 설치 프로세스 중 오류 처리에 대한 특정 이해. 이러한 방식으로 Linux 시스템에 Oracle을 설치하는 것은 더 이상 골치 아픈 일이 아닙니다.
위 내용은 Linux 시스템에서 Oracle의 설치 경로에 대한 자세한 소개의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undress AI Tool
무료로 이미지를 벗다

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Clothoff.io
AI 옷 제거제

Video Face Swap
완전히 무료인 AI 얼굴 교환 도구를 사용하여 모든 비디오의 얼굴을 쉽게 바꾸세요!

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

선택*Fromv $ 버전; 데이터베이스, PL/SQL, 핵심 라이브러리 등을 포함하여 Oracle 데이터베이스의 전체 버전 정보를 얻을 수 있습니다. 버전 세부 사항은 DBA에 가장 일반적으로 사용되는 신뢰할 수있는 방법입니다. 2. SelectbannerFromv $ versionwherebanner -like'oracle%'사용; Oracle 데이터베이스의 기본 버전 정보 만 표시 할 수 있습니다. 3. Product_component_version보기를 쿼리하려면 각 Oracle 구성 요소의 버전을 가져옵니다. 4. SQLPLUS-V 명령을 통해 데이터베이스에 로그인하지 않고 클라이언트 또는 서버 도구 버전을 볼 수 있지만 실제 실행에 반영되지 않을 수 있습니다.

oraclesupportsjsondatatypesandoperationssinceoracle12c, enablefefficientstorage, querying, and anmanipulaturedsemi-structureddatawithinarelationalssqlenvironment.1.jsondataisstoredusingvarchar2, clob, clob, 또는 blobteypesson)

theoracleOptimizerDeteMinestErminesteMosteMosteFiciteWayexeCutesQlByAnalyzingExecutionPlansBasedOnStaticsandCostestimation.1.ITDECIDESHOWOACCESSDATA (indexusage, tableJoinOrder 및 JoinMethods.2.ItestimatesCostusingTableAndsyStystemStatistics 및 Proped

oraclesequences 및 IdentityColumns는 자체 값을 얻을 수 있지만 메커니즘은 해당 시나리오와 다릅니다. 1. Oracle 시퀀스는 테이블에서 사용할 수있는 독립적 인 객체이며 캐시, 루핑 등과 같은 더 높은 제어 유연성을 제공합니다. 2. 아이덴티티 열은 테이블 열에 자체 개수 로직을 포함하여 간단한 시나리오에 적합하고 MySQL/PostgreSQL 사용에 더 가깝게 설정을 단순화합니다. 3. 주요 차이점은 동작 범위 (서열이 전 세계적으로 이용 가능하고, 아이덴티티 열은 단일 테이블로 제한됨), 제어 능력 (서열 기능이 더 강함) 및 사용 편의성 (ID 열이 더 직관적)입니다. 4. 간단한 시나리오에서 ID 열을 사용하는 것이 좋습니다. 복잡한 시스템 또는 공유 카운터가 필요한 경우 시퀀스가 선호됩니다.

DBA 권한이있는 사용자에게 연결; 2. CreateUser 명령을 사용하여 사용자를 작성하고 필요한 매개 변수를 지정하십시오. 3. 생성, 생성 가능 등과 같은 시스템 권한을 부여하거나 연결 및 자원 역할을 사용합니다. 4. 필요에 따라 CreateProcedure 또는 UnlimitedTablespace와 같은 추가 권한을 부여하십시오. 5. 선택적으로 다른 사용자 객체에 객체 권한을 부여합니다. 6. 사용자 로그인을 확인하십시오. 전체 프로세스는 올바른 컨테이너에서 실행되고 최소 권한의 원리를 따라 강력한 암호 정책을 사용하며 최종적으로 Oracle 사용자 생성 및 권한 할당을 완료해야합니다.

oraclesql의 사례 명령문은 쿼리에서 조건부 로직을 구현하는 데 사용됩니다. 2. 검색 사례는 급여 수준으로 분류 된 스코프 또는 복잡한 논리에 적합한 여러 부울 조건을 평가하는 데 사용됩니다. 3. 사례는 Select, Orderby, 여기서 (간접), Groupby 및 클로스가있는 데 사용할 수 있으며 데이터 변환, 정렬, 필터링 및 그룹화를 구현할 수 있습니다. 4. 모범 사례에는 항상 널을 방지하기 위해 항상 다른 사용, 결말을 끝내고, 결과 열에 별명을 추가하고, 과도한 중첩을 피하는 것이 포함됩니다. 5. 오래된 디코드와 비교합니다

thelistener.orafileissentialforconfiging theoraclenetlistenertoacceptandrouteclientconnectionrequests; itdefinesListeningAddressesandports, specifiesDatabaseServicesViasticaticregistration, andSetSlestenerParameterslikeloggingArgingArcing; $ oracl;

Usethe || OperatortoconcateNatemultiplecolumnsinoracle, AsitismorepracticalandflexibleThancOncat (); 2. AddSeparatorslikespacesOrcommasSupteSquotes;
